From: sje Date: Sat, 24 Feb 2007 00:11:39 +0000 (+0000) Subject: PR debug/29614 X-Git-Url: http://git.sourceforge.jp/view?p=pf3gnuchains%2Fgcc-fork.git;a=commitdiff_plain;h=11cc227f55cc657aa83852e7c3592db2a2e2d91b PR debug/29614 * varpool.c (varpool_assemble_pending_decls): Set varpool_last_needed_node to null. git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@122277 138bc75d-0d04-0410-961f-82ee72b054a4 --- diff --git a/gcc/ChangeLog b/gcc/ChangeLog index 3fdbf78489a..cb4e0986965 100644 --- a/gcc/ChangeLog +++ b/gcc/ChangeLog @@ -1,3 +1,9 @@ +2007-02-23 Steve Ellcey + + PR debug/29614 + * varpool.c (varpool_assemble_pending_decls): Set + varpool_last_needed_node to null. + 2007-02-23 DJ Delorie * config/i386/i386.c (ix86_data_alignment): Don't specify an diff --git a/gcc/varpool.c b/gcc/varpool.c index 65c22d491b4..7791ada4bc3 100644 --- a/gcc/varpool.c +++ b/gcc/varpool.c @@ -430,6 +430,9 @@ varpool_assemble_pending_decls (void) else node->next_needed = NULL; } + /* varpool_nodes_queue is now empty, clear the pointer to the last element + in the queue. */ + varpool_last_needed_node = NULL; return changed; }